Output 8cb122d32c7d866893b0d3340adb0e71bde3c79985a4cddfb644b4df4f752ab5:2

value
30428139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 156880f3ee60bea3c53c2bca23df20cf35ec27dd OP_EQUAL
address
M9rMcWDW2QFVQVcHgbSJNq7KacySGkfbtA
transaction
8cb122d32c7d866893b0d3340adb0e71bde3c79985a4cddfb644b4df4f752ab5
spent
true